Changan Auto H1 net profit up 3.68 pct

From XFN-ASIA| August 30 , 2008 16:47 BJT

Chongqing Changan Automobile Co Ltd said its first half net profit rose 3.68 pct year-on-year to 450.19 mln yuan under Chinese accounting standards, mainly due to higher sales at Changan Ford Mazda Automobile Co Ltd, its 50-50 joint venture with Ford Motor Co.

The company said it produced 455,688 vehicles in the first six months, up 19.37 pct from a year earlier, and sold 438,259, up 10.83 pct, including 386,815 cars and 51,444 commercial vehicles.

The sales figures include vehicles manufactured by its joint ventures with Ford and Suzuki Motor Corp.

Chongqing Changan Automobile said its share of first-half earnings of Changan Ford Mazda and the venture's engine unit grew by 48.88 mln yuan and 74.87 bln yuan, respectively. It did not provide the total earnings figures.

Total operating revenue in the first half rose 9.21 pct to 7.88 bln yuan. Earnings per share were 0.19 yuan, against 0.22 yuan a year earlier.

Under international accounting standards, net profit for the first half was 455.31 mln yuan. It gave no comparative figure.
